              sndifns0dfsndfn β€” 9 months ago(June 21, 2025 01:42 PM)

              I mean there's window units, or single hose portable, or double hose portable.
              If you have a single hose portable, you have to make sure there is no unsealed crevice anywhere because single hose AC units create negative pressure and it will just bring in outside air to the room(and all the outside humidity with it).

                    sndifns0dfsndfn β€” 9 months ago(June 21, 2025 02:04 PM)

                    Depends on the brand I guess. Mine was a bit annoying but I bought this tape:
                    https://www.amazon.com/XFasten-Transparent-Weather-Sealing-Isolation/dp/B07PDRY2T2
                    I used this to seal up the window where the hose is set up. I just put the tape anywhere that I thought might have air leaking inside and that solved all the issues with negative pressure bringing humidity in. You'll know it's all sealed when you try to slowly close the room's door and you can feel the negative pressure trying to suck the door back into the room.
                    Of course it will be a pain to take it down later if I want to use the window normally but that might not be a problem for you. I have vertical sliding windows and they didn't play nice with my AC unit's hose so I had to use a lot of tape. If you have normal windows it'll be ALOT easier to tape up the gaps.
